Just watched the whole thing, great interview. It's clear Tom is incredibly passionate about his TTS stuff, here are the highlights (Blink stuff was around ~37:00, below in bold):

-Atom was going to join them on this tour, AVA is a “revolving door of artists
-TTS couldn’t handle the AVA release from a bandwidth standpoint, so signed with a record label
-sold Strange Times to TBS
-new AVA album will go with a movie he co-wrote, supposed to be filming in 3 weeks
-wants to get AVA to a big arena for a full experience, people are like “You’re high, why did you leave blink-182?
-“The stuff I have in my head that I can’t talk about is just absolutely unreal.
-Absolutely believes aliens exist and UFOs have entered our atmosphere. “One trillion percent. I’ve seen stuff that 99.9999% of people will never see.
-When Wall Street Journal leaked convos with Podesta, he felt legitimized finally “People thought I was nuts.
-“No one understood why I wasn’t in Blink anymore. No one understood why I was singing songs about love and consciousness. And then one understood the UFO thing, they just thought I was literally nuts. It’s been a long road to get people to understand. But I’m a punk rocker, I do what I want.”
-People are seeing this stuff now, they’re seeing the creative differences in what I do, and what my brothers in Blink do. We like different things. We like different music. We’re still good friends, we still support each other.
-“Yes people, I will play with Blink again. I talk to Travis all the time. I talked to Mark the other day, we’re always discussing what makes sense and when.
-“When I was starting this stuff, I couldn’t tell those guys. So they didn’t know, that was one of the reasons they got so upset I think And this is when the whole meltdown happened.  We gotta record, we gotta record, and I’m like I can’t right now guys.
-I remember thinking, “If only anyone knew. For the first time in the history of mankind I created a mechanism to have these conversations.
-Working on a project with the Padres
-Unidentified airs on May 31st, tv series. He produced/directed.
-Next record will be defining record for AVA. Getting Ilan on this has been such a wonderful growth.
-"Being in a giant rockband, and leaving it, and trying to start all over again, I’m thankful for you guys playing it [Rebel Girl]."
